I have miata 1997 power steering and A/C. A friend of mine have a miata 1992 supercharger and he is going to sell his car. He give me the Moos jackson racing supercharger.... Mod 999-156. My question is what i have to do o what I need to buy to fit it on my 97. T.k.

In short, it won't. Search more before posting please. '92 and '97 have different port spacing to say the least, and it will not bolt up. If it's made for the 1.6, I highly doubt there's a compatible kit for the '97 that would allow you to bolt it on to your larger engine. /Thread
